Job Summary

Own multi-channel paid media strategy and execution with a focus on Meta, Google, and rising platforms, while driving profitability through unit economics and testing discipline.

  • Collaborate with leadership on revenue forecasts and spend modeling to align with margin goals.
  • Build a structured testing engine, dashboards, and attribution model checks to optimize CAC, ROAS, and LTV.
  • Scale new channels and manage a $250K+ monthly budget to hit blended performance targets and incremental growth.

Job Description

  • Own strategy and execution across Meta, Google (Search, Shopping, YouTube), and emerging paid channels
  • Manage and optimize $250K+ monthly advertising budget
  • Allocate spend dynamically based on performance and incrementality
  • Identify and scale new performance channels (Linear TV, TikTok, affiliate, retail media, etc.)
  • Own MER, CAC, blended ROAS, LTV, and new customer acquisition targets
  • Align marketing spend with contribution margin and profitability goals
  • Partner with leadership on revenue forecasting and spend modeling
  • Present performance insights and scaling plans to executive team
  • Build and maintain a structured creative testing engine in partnership with Head of Creative
  • Establish clear testing cadences (creative, landing pages, offers, funnels)

Requirements

  • 7+ years in DTC ecommerce performance marketing
  • Personally managed $250K+ monthly paid media budgets (preferably $500K+)
  • Experience scaling physical product brands to $100M+ in annual revenue
  • Deep expertise in Meta and Google ecosystems
  • Strong understanding of unit economics, contribution margin, and blended performance metrics
  • Proven track record building structured testing systems
